* arch-utils.c (gdbarch_info_init): Set osabi to
GDB_OSABI_UNINITIALIZED. * gdbarch.sh: Add osabi to struct gdbarch and to struct gdbarch_info. Include "osabi.h" in gdbarch.c. Check osabi in gdbarch_list_lookup_by_info and in gdbarch_update_p. * gdbarch.c: Regenerated. * gdbarch.h: Regenerated. * osabi.c (gdbarch_lookup_osabi): Return GDB_OSABI_UNINITIALIZED if there's no BFD. (gdbarch_init_osabi): Remove osabi argument; use info.osabi. * osabi.h (enum gdb_osabi): Move to defs.h. (gdbarch_init_osabi): Update prototype. * defs.h (enum gdb_osabi): Moved here. * Makefile.in: Update dependencies. Plus updates to alpha, arm, hppa, i386, mips, ns32k, ppc, sh, sparc, and vax ports to match.
